Index: uspace/lib/c/generic/vfs/vfs.c
===================================================================
--- uspace/lib/c/generic/vfs/vfs.c	(revision a53ed3a8097360ccf174e8d94fb407db919eb66a)
+++ uspace/lib/c/generic/vfs/vfs.c	(revision 36df27ebb72758daf4d2179e70f231ac0e059a83)
@@ -1279,4 +1279,7 @@
 	async_wait_for(req, &rc_orig);
 
+	// XXX: Workaround for GCC diagnostics.
+	*handle = -1;
+
 	if (rc_orig != EOK)
 		return (errno_t) rc_orig;
